Output 23629d19efa5d174fb6b45d594e8e2abcf272c682382fa00d8d3e76a2b40bee6:0

value
183756
script pubkey
OP_0 OP_PUSHBYTES_20 38aacdebbb05253dc515fcdf31bb2d44d34da045
address
bc1q8z4vm6amq5jnm3g4ln0nrwedgnf5mgz96jtc4k
transaction
23629d19efa5d174fb6b45d594e8e2abcf272c682382fa00d8d3e76a2b40bee6
spent
true